Housing stock across Wayne County spans everything from mid-century ranches to new construction subdivisions. Older homes here commonly show aging electrical panels, original plumbing, settled foundations, and roofs at the end of their service life. Newer builds carry their own issues — rushed grading, incomplete flashing, and HVAC installations that were never properly commissioned. Both need someone who knows what to look for.
Every Grosse Pointe inspection is a complete visual evaluation of the home's major systems: roof and exterior, foundation and structure, electrical, heating and cooling, plumbing, attic and insulation, and interior components. You receive a photo-documented report within 24 hours, written in plain English with practical priorities — what matters now, what can wait, and what it's likely to cost.
